Output 6cbca2bbf721a6d1301a1dd2fc9df71b604681c8a40d2b4b96ac23564b575425:0

value
530079024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b6a8ba423d2c3c2796518236d0576c06dd8f82 OP_EQUAL
address
3QBWy7M8hjshuh538iCHPetEykT8oBJP4q
transaction
6cbca2bbf721a6d1301a1dd2fc9df71b604681c8a40d2b4b96ac23564b575425
spent
true